McDonald’s $5 Meal Deal Highlights Inflation Battle McDonald’s new $5 Meal Deal, debuting Tuesday, offers a McChicken or McBurger, chicken nuggets, fries, and a drink for less than a Big Mac, highlighting a shift in the fight against inflation. This promotion comes as the U.S. inflation rate slows, with prices up 3.3% in May compared to 4% the previous year and 8.6% the year before that.
